Post by Xangxa on May 6, 2005 12:21:47 GMT -5
Version 1.03 of PushPins.exe is available:- Add INI file support to allow parameters to be passed by a configuration file. Command line parameters can also be used simultaneously and they take precedence over duplicate settings in the INI file. This program will now prompt the user for any pieces that do not have a default value and are not supplied by either method.
- Time delay for loading and changing of entire data sets is now calculated instead of being a hard coded delay. Small data sets will not be unnecessarily cause delays and larger datasets will have enough time to process. Eventually the delay factor will be parameterized so that users with slower machines can adjust this to their particular environment.
- Add third parameter to control file that controls balloon fields. Each character in the third field is either Y or N and determines if a balloon field should be shown. If the third parameter is missing then no balloon field processing will take place. The parameter must have the exact same number of characters as the balloon fields available. Currently 8 being sent by GSAK/GPSBabel, so the most common parameter will be YYYNYYYY since this turns off the URL (it isn't helpful information for most people, it takes up valuable balloon space -- which can force some information out-of-bounds [not visible], and Ctrl-click will still open the cache page whether it is displayed or not. NOTE: this program assumes that the FIRST TWO fields [latitude and longitude] are ALREADY turned on! This works fine for GSAK 5.5.1 and MSST 2005 but different versions may work differently. If this should occur to you, use the opposite values than expected to get the desired results.
- GSAK example macro PUSHPINS.TXT should have included the WAIT=YES parameter when shelling to DOS
- GSAK example macro PUSHPINS.TXT now includes balloon field controls that turn off URL display.
- GSAK example macro PUSHPINS.TXT was missing an entry for TerraCaches. Also renamed the 3 occurences of the vauge TC abbreviation so now the data set displays the much clearer "TerraCaches" in MSST.
